Ijma or consensus based decision making and its effects on private and social well being, and economic prosperity
The objective of this study is to examine how to make correct decision by pursuing Ijma or consensus-based decision-making process, and thus it is possible to maximize private and social wellbeing as well as economic prosperity. The current study is based on purely theoretical and multiple regression model. In addition, partial derivatives are applied for analyzing the individual effects of each of the explanatory variables. The findings suggest that if correct decisions are made based on Ijma or consensus, then it is expected that private and social wellbeing as well as economic prosperity will be maximized. However, the success of Ijma depends on the qualifications of the experts and learned scholars, practical experiences and previous success and track record of the scholars and experts. Consensus of the scholars and experts, in-depth knowledge of Quran, Sunnah, Ijma, Qiyas, Ijtihad and Maslaha, and the speed of implementation of a particular decision and support services are the major determinants of the success in Ijma based decision making. This study is one of the latest attempts to evaluate the effects of Ijma based decision making on private and social wellbeing as well as on the economic prosperity. This study will be extremely useful to decision makers, Shari'ah scholars, Judges, governments, policy makers, research scholars, students, and academicians across the globe.
